Output faed203128b11708de9851ff8fa1fe96b41235048196d103ee723b001565f24e:5

value
578355
script pubkey
OP_0 OP_PUSHBYTES_20 7895b3b89d81b0bc3fa965ee1b696b77a04c542f
address
bc1q0z2m8wyasxctc0afvhhpk6ttw7syc4p0239d03
transaction
faed203128b11708de9851ff8fa1fe96b41235048196d103ee723b001565f24e
confirmations
108057
spent
true